Resetting the printer's internal counter

After you empty the hole punch box, reset the internal counter to clear the
message. Resetting the counter helps prevent service calls
Empty Box K
by ensuring that the printer alerts you when the hole punch box again
becomes full. The reset process only takes a few minutes.
